Retaining Wall Demolition in Sacramento, CA
Retaining wall demolition services involve the careful removal of existing retaining structures that no longer serve their purpose or need replacement. These projects typically include dismantling concrete, stone, or wood retaining walls that are used to hold back soil, define landscape features, or prevent erosion. Homeowners seeking these services often want to understand the scope of demolition, the impact on their property, and any necessary preparations before work begins. Proper planning ensures that nearby landscaping, utilities, and property boundaries are protected during the removal process.
Property owners requesting retaining wall demolition usually want to know about the potential for site clearing, debris removal, and the options for rebuilding or replacing the wall afterward. It’s important to consider factors such as existing wall material, the wall’s condition, and how the demolition may affect surrounding structures or landscaping. Clear communication about the process can help ensure that the project meets expectations and that any concerns about soil stability or property access are addressed prior to starting work.

Retaining Wall Demolition Questions
What is retaining wall demolition? It involves safely removing existing retaining walls to clear space or prepare for new construction projects.
When is retaining wall demolition necessary? Demolition is needed when walls are damaged, no longer serve their purpose, or need replacement due to age or design changes.
What types of retaining walls can be demolished? Various types, including concrete, stone, and timber walls, can be dismantled based on the project requirements.
What should property owners consider before demolition? It’s important to assess the structural stability of nearby structures and ensure proper disposal of debris.
